The challenge of unstable loads in warehouse environments

Warehouses are fast moving environments where goods are constantly being received, picked, and dispatched. In these settings, pallets often carry mixed loads of boxes, cartons, or packaged goods that can easily shift during handling.

Without effective pallet restraint systems, items may move during internal transport, forklift handling, or while stored on racking. This creates several operational challenges.

First, unstable loads increase the risk of product damage. When cartons slide or collapse, goods can become dented, crushed, or unsellable. In high volume distribution centres, even small levels of damage can quickly lead to significant losses.

Second, unstable pallets create safety concerns for warehouse teams. Boxes that fall during handling can cause injury, obstruct walkways, or create hazards in busy picking aisles.

Finally, poorly secured loads often require additional packaging such as plastic wrap or disposable securing materials. While these methods can stabilise goods temporarily, they generate waste and add time to packing operations.

These challenges are why many warehouses now rely on warehouse safety straps and pallet restraint straps to stabilise loads during storage and transport.

Reducing plastic wrap with reusable load restraint straps

Plastic shrink wrap has long been used to stabilise pallet loads in warehouses. However, it is typically used once and then discarded, creating large volumes of plastic waste.

Reusable load restraint straps offer a more sustainable alternative. These systems allow goods to be secured repeatedly without relying on disposable packaging materials.

Where warehouse straps are commonly used

Warehouse straps are used across a wide range of logistics operations where goods need to remain stable during storage or movement.

One common use is securing mixed pallets during internal transport. When pallets move between storage areas and packing stations, reusable straps prevent cartons from sliding or collapsing.

Another important application is securing goods inside roll cages. Retail distribution centres often move products through warehouses using roll cage trolleys, where items can easily shift during movement. Using roll cage trolley straps provides a simple way to keep goods contained and secure while cages are moved across busy warehouse floors.

Warehouse straps can also be used to stabilise loads on racking systems. By securing cartons together, straps reduce the risk of boxes slipping or falling when pallets are accessed.

These practical applications make reusable strapping systems valuable tools in warehouses handling high volumes of goods each day.
